The University of Manitoba in Canada is offering fully funded scholarships for the year 2024. These scholarships provide an excellent opportunity for students to pursue their undergraduate, master’s, or PhD degrees without the financial burden. The University of Manitoba is renowned for its commitment to academic excellence and offers a wide range of programs across various disciplines.

Scholarship Summary

The fully funded scholarships at the University of Manitoba cover tuition fees, living expenses, and other related costs for the duration of the program. This means that students can focus on their studies and research without worrying about financial constraints. The scholarships are awarded based on merit and are highly competitive.

Eligibility Requirements for the Scholarship

To be eligible for the fully funded scholarships at the University of Manitoba, applicants must meet the following criteria:

For undergraduate scholarships: Applicants must have completed high school or equivalent and meet the admission requirements of the University of Manitoba. They should also demonstrate outstanding academic achievements and leadership potential.

For master’s scholarships: Applicants must have a bachelor’s degree or equivalent from a recognized institution. They should have a strong academic background and research potential in their chosen field of study.

For PhD scholarships: Applicants must have a master’s degree or equivalent from a recognized institution. They should have a proven track record of research excellence and the potential to make significant contributions to their field of study.

Benefits of the Scholarship

The fully funded scholarships at the University of Manitoba offer numerous benefits to the recipients. These include:

1. Full coverage of tuition fees: The scholarship covers the entire cost of tuition fees for the duration of the program, allowing students to focus on their studies without financial worries.

2. Living expenses: The scholarship provides a stipend to cover living expenses, ensuring that students can afford accommodation, meals, and other necessary expenses.

3. Research funding: For master’s and PhD students, the scholarship may also include additional funding for research projects, conferences, and other academic activities.

4. Networking opportunities: Scholarship recipients have the opportunity to connect with renowned professors, researchers, and fellow students, creating valuable networks and collaborations.

5. International exposure: Studying at the University of Manitoba offers students the chance to experience a multicultural and diverse environment, enhancing their global perspective and intercultural skills.

How to Apply

To apply for the fully funded scholarships at the University of Manitoba, applicants need to follow these steps:

1. Research the available scholarships: Visit the University of Manitoba’s official website to explore the different scholarships available and determine which ones align with your academic goals and interests.

2. Check the eligibility criteria: Ensure that you meet the eligibility requirements for the scholarship you wish to apply for. Pay attention to any specific requirements or documentation needed.

3. Prepare your application materials: Gather all the necessary documents, including academic transcripts, letters of recommendation, a statement of purpose, and any additional requirements specified by the scholarship.

4. Submit your application: Follow the instructions provided on the scholarship application portal to submit your application online. Make sure to complete all the required fields and attach the necessary documents.

5. Await the decision: The selection process may take some time, so be patient. If shortlisted, you may be called for an interview or asked to provide additional information.

Application Deadline

1st of December 2024
